2016-12-01 48 views
0

我想扩展验证设置另一场就是这样:如何编辑或扩展laravel5.3中的错误消息?

return Validator::make($data, [ 
    'name' => 'required|max:255', 
    'email' => 'required|email|max:255|unique:users', 
    'password' => 'required|min:6|confirmed', 
    'another_field' => 'validation' 
]); 
+0

好的感谢您的编辑。必须有助于提出进一步的问题。 –

回答

0

您可以通过follwing的documentation :)

+0

伟大的,但我需要更具体的一个或任何其他文件。谢谢你的答案。 –

+0

你可以找到[这里](https://laracasts.com/discuss/channels/general-discussion/custom-validation-function-in-laravel-5/replies/152118)一个完整的代码示例,我认为它会工作5.3也 –

+0

好的谢谢。这将有所帮助,我希望。 –

0

让自己的验证情况下,如果你只需要改变的消息,你可以做它由

$messages = [ 
    'required' => 'The :attribute field is required.', 
    'email' => 'This is a wrong e-mail address message I wrote myself.', 
]; 

$rules = [ 
    'name' => 'required|max:255', 
    'email' => 'required|email|max:255|unique:users', 
    'password' => 'required|min:6|confirmed', 
    'another_field' => 'validation' 
]; 

return Validator::make($input, $rules, $messages);